They can happen again and again as you restart the system and to recover from it. If you are lucky, you might not have to reformat the system, because that will erase all your important data. Two general reasons behind BSOD errors are a hardware failure (hard disk crash, damaged SATA cable, RAM), or a software failure (Corrupt File System Files, BIOS settings, Malfunctioned programs, Virus attack).</p><p>After every crash, the operating system records the information stating the reason of crash, date and time, corrupted driver location, and lines of code to the system minidump folders located at C:\Windows\Minidump. If you can&#8217;t find the files at their default location, that means someone has altered the location or renamed it, and you&#8217;ll have to correct a few Windows settings.</p><p>Follow the instructions below to configure Windows so that Windows can create this specific folder and record the information whenever BSOD errors to your system:</p><h3>For Windows XP</h3><p>Right click on &#8216;My Computer&#8217; and go to properties, alternatively you can go to control panel and double click on &#8216;system&#8217; icon.</p><p><img src="http://cache.techie-buzz.com/images4/c2/07/system-properties.png" alt="" /></p><p>Find the &#8216;Advanced&#8217; tab and then &#8216;Startup &amp; Recovery&#8217; frame. Click on &#8216;Settings&#8217; located under &#8216;Startup and Recovery&#8217; frame and find the section named &#8216;Write debugging information&#8217; and then set the value from drop down menu to &#8216;Small memory dump(64 KB)&#8217;</p><p><img src="http://cache.techie-buzz.com/images4/c2/07/startup-recovery-settings.png" alt="" /></p><p>To confirm, Click &#8216;OK&#8217;</p><h3>For Windows 7</h3><p>All the steps here are the same as Windows XP, but in order to find &#8216;System properties&#8217; tab, You have to go at &#8216;Control panel&#8217; and then &#8216;System &amp; Security&#8217; and then &#8216;System&#8217;.</p><p>Change in the registry<br /> Make the following changes in your registry:<br /> [H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Control\CrashControl]<br /> &#8220;CrashDumpEnabled&#8221;=dword:00000003</p><p>After that, you have to restart the system to make your changes take effect.</p><p>Once you are able to find your minidump files, you&#8217;ll have to <a href="http://www.microsoft.com/whdc/DevTools/Debugging/default.mspx" target="_blank">download Debugging Tools for Windows including WinDbg</a> to decipher the information contained in the them, because the they can&#8217;t be open using notepad.</p><p><strong>==== About The Author ====</strong></p><p>Oliver is a computer hardware/software geek and would love to explore the information about latest technologies, PC tips and tricks. If you are seeing problems with fonts in MS Word or PDF files, you might find the answers here.]]></description> <content:encoded><![CDATA[<img src="http://cache.techie-buzz.com/13380336536xlhy3k2309gmvjngxqscumbag1338033653iar6hkbkql1aueuc1ai41338033653.png" class="scumbags" /><p>If you are a Windows user, then you might have faced a situation where your windows fonts had gotten corrupted. Actually, there are many probable reasons for this issue. The first one being that you may have accidentally deleted some font file, or some program has replaced your font files and now the system is unable to read it. This can make your MS Word or PDF documents unreadable. Today, I am going to list the possible solutions for this issue.</p><p><strong>Possible solutions:</strong></p><p><strong>Method 1:</strong> This will be applicable only if you already know which font file is corrupted. In this case, you simply have to remove the corrupted font and then install it again.</p><p>1. First, open the Run window by using the keys “Win+R”, in the window, type “fonts”.<br /> 2. In the Fonts window, select the font that has been corrupted and then right click it and select the option that says “delete”.</p><p><img src="http://cache.techie-buzz.com/images4/c2/04/win7_delete_font.png" alt="" /></p><p>3. After deleting the font, restart the system and then download a fresh copy of the corrupted font from internet.<br /> 4. Now right click on the downloaded font and select the option “Install”.</p><p><img src="http://cache.techie-buzz.com/images4/c2/04/win7-font-install.png" alt="" /></p><p>5. After the installation is done you have to restart the system so that the font gets registered. Font registration is an automatic process which is done only after restarting the system.<br /> 6. So, after the reboot, the font will be working successfully. If it’s not working, then you can try Method 2.</p><p><strong>Method 2:</strong> This time, we are going to restore the font’s folder to its original state, so that any changes that may have caused the font corruption will be over-written.</p><p>1. In Windows, click the Start button and navigate to Control Panel &gt; Appearance and Personalization &gt; Fonts.<br /> 2. In the Fonts window there is a “Font Settings” option in the left pane.</p><p><img src="http://cache.techie-buzz.com/images4/c2/04/win7-font-settings.png" alt="" /></p><p>3. Click “Restore default font settings”; this will restore all the font settings to initial state.</p><p><img src="http://cache.techie-buzz.com/images4/c2/04/win7-restore-font-settings.png" alt="" /></p><p>4. After this, your fonts should get repaired, but if it is still not working then you should go for the third method.</p><p><strong>Method 3:</strong> If neither of the above methods worked for you, then you can use third party software to fix your font folder. <em>Fix Fonts Folder</em> is a utility that locates and fixes font related problems on Windows systems (Vista and Windows 7). It scans all installed fonts and checks their integrity and their corresponding registry keys. If there are any corrupt fonts then it offers an option to fix them. You can download this utility from here: <a href="http://fix-fonts-folder.en.softonic.com/" target="_blank">http://fix-fonts-folder.en.softonic.com/</a></p><p><img src="http://cache.techie-buzz.com/images4/c2/04/screenshot-fix-font-folders.png" alt="" width="590" height="284" /></p><p>Hopefully, one of the above methods helped. He initially noticed it on the Microsoft Japan webpage, but shortly after received confirmation from Microsoft U.S. PR that this revision is in fact valid.]]></description> <content:encoded><![CDATA[<img src="http://cache.techie-buzz.com/1338033653y6n46kkd59udw15a4grascumbag1338033653ungm3g95aujdhhqxwz6f1338033653.god" class="scumbags" /><p><a href="http://www.zdnet.com/blog/bott/microsoft-quietly-extends-consumer-support-for-windows-7-vista/">Ed Bott of ZDNet</a> managed to spot a revision that Microsoft snuck into its support policy sometime this month that ups the support duration ante for Microsoft&#8217;s two latest consumer operating systems &#8212; Vista and 7 &#8212; to 10 years. He initially noticed it on the Microsoft Japan webpage, but shortly after received confirmation from Microsoft U.S. PR that this revision is in fact valid:</p><blockquote><p><em>Microsoft is updating the Support Lifecycle policy for Windows desktop operating systems, including Windows XP, Windows Vista and Windows 7.</em></p><p><em>The update will provide a more consistent and predictable experience for customers using  Microsoft Windows operating systems across OEM, consumer and business editions.</em></p><p><em>Microsoft still requires that customers have the most current Service Pack installed in order to continue to receive updates.</em></p><p><em>Through this update, customers who remain on the most current supported service pack will be eligible to receive both Mainstream and Extended Support, for a total of 10 years. </em></p></blockquote><p>Bott notes that one must not mistake the support lifecycle of Windows for its sales lifecycle; you can&#8217;t purchase a retail copy of XP or Vista today. Once Windows 8 launches later this year, Microsoft will be supporting a total of 4 operating systems at once, until Windows XP reaches the end of its support lifecycle on April 4th, 2014. That&#8217;s right; in about two years, the OS that has clung onto the PCs of various users worldwide will finally not be supported. The codec pack allows you to import, organize, and edit RAW files without using third-party plugins or applications.]]></description> <content:encoded><![CDATA[<img src="http://cache.techie-buzz.com/1338033653dyofpofkjkysztw2bllscumbag1338033653g9n1ehr58yipn8a4tcc81338033653.god" class="scumbags" /><p>Microsoft has released <strong><a href="http://www.microsoft.com/download/en/details.aspx?id=26829" target="_blank">Microsoft Camera Codec Pack</a></strong> that enables the viewing of a variety of device-specific file formats. The codec pack allows you to import, organize, and edit RAW files without using third-party plugins or applications.</p><p>A RAW file is the uncompressed output from each of the original pixels on the camera&#8217;s image sensors. RAW files have higher image quality than JPEG files and have more image information. Microsoft Camera Codec Pack lets you view RAW files from over 120 digital SLR devices in Windows Live Photo Gallery as well as in Windows Explorer. The files can also be viewed in other applications that are based on Windows Imaging Codecs (WIC). This pack is available in both the x86 and x64 versions for Windows Vista Service Pack 2 and Windows 7.</p><p>Once the codec pack is installed, you can edit copies of your RAW images in Windows Live Photo Gallery. Within Photo Gallery, make a JPEG or JPEG-XR (or HD-photo) copy of the original photo, and then apply different editing effects available. You can even use the RAW files to stitch panoramas using Photo Gallery.</p><p>The Microsoft Camera Codec Pack provides support for the following device formats:</p><ul><li><strong>Canon:</strong> EOS 1000D (<em>EOS Kiss F in Japan and the EOS Rebel XS in North America</em>), EOS 10D, EOS 1D Mk2, EOS 1D Mk3, EOS 1D Mk4, EOS 1D Mk2 N, EOS 1Ds Mk2, EOS 1Ds Mk3, EOS 20D, EOS 300D (<em>the Kiss Digital in Japan and the Digital Rebel in North America</em>) , EOS 30D, EOS 350D (<em>the Canon EOS Kiss Digital N in Japan and EOS Digital Rebel XT in North America</em>), EOS 400D (<em>the Kiss Digital X in Japan and the Digital Rebel XTi in North America</em>), EOS 40D, EOS 450D (<em>EOS Kiss X2 in Japan and the EOS Rebel XSi in North America</em>), EOS 500D (<em>EOS Kiss X3 in Japan and the EOS Rebel T1i in North America</em>), EOS 550D (<em>EOS Kiss X4 in Japan, and as the EOS Rebel T2i in North America</em>), EOS 50D, EOS 5D, EOS 5D Mk2, EOS 7D, EOS D30, EOS D60, G2, G3, G5, G6, G9, G10, G11, Pro1, S90</li><li><strong>Nikon:</strong> D100, D1H, D200, D2H, D2Hs, D2X, D2Xs, D3, D3s, D300, D3000, D300s, D3X, D40, D40x, D50, D5000, D60, D70, D700, D70s, D80, D90, P6000</li><li><strong>Sony:</strong> A100, A200, A230, A300, A330, A350, A380, A700, A850, A900, DSC-R1</li><li><strong>Olympus:</strong> C7070, C8080, E1, E10, E20, E3, E30, E300, E330, E400, E410, E420, E450, E500, E510, E520, E620, EP1</li><li><strong>Pentax (<em>PEF formats only</em>):</strong> K100D, K100D Super, K10D, K110D, K200D, K20D, K7, K-x, *ist D, *ist DL, *ist DS</li><li><strong>Leica:</strong> Digilux 3, D-LUX4, M8, M9</li><li><strong>Minolta:</strong> DiMage A1, DiMage A2, Maxxum 7D (<em>Dynax 7D in Europe, Î±-7 Digital in Japan</em>)</li><li><strong>Epson:</strong> RD1</li><li><strong>Panasonic:</strong> G1, GH1, GF1, LX3</li></ul> <img src="http://cache.techie-buzz.com/1338033653dyofpofkjkysztw2bllscumbag1338033653g9n1ehr58yipn8a4tcc81338033653.god" class="scumbags" /><div style="font-size:12px"> <strong>Share:</strong> <a href="http://techie-buzz.com/microsoft/how-to-view-and-edit-raw-photos-on-windows-live-photo-gallery.html#commentrespond" rel="bookmark" target="_blank">Comment on This Post</a> | <a href="http://twitter.com/home?source=techiebuzz&status=How-To View and Edit RAW Photos in Windows Live Photo Gallery http%3A%2F%2Fbit.ly%2Fo9QLqx via @techiebuzzer" rel="bookmark" target="_blank">Tweet This</a> | <a href="http://www.facebook.com/sharer.php?u=http://techie-buzz.com/microsoft/how-to-view-and-edit-raw-photos-on-windows-live-photo-gallery.html" rel="bookmark" target="_blank">Share on Facebook</a> | <a href="http://del.icio.us/post?url=http://techie-buzz.com/microsoft/how-to-view-and-edit-raw-photos-on-windows-live-photo-gallery.html&title=How-To View and Edit RAW Photos in Windows Live Photo Gallery" rel="bookmark" target="_blank">Save to Delicious</a> | <a href="http://www.stumbleupon.com/submit?url=http://techie-buzz.com/microsoft/how-to-view-and-edit-raw-photos-on-windows-live-photo-gallery.html" rel="bookmark" target="_blank">Stumble This</a> | <a href="http://digg.com/submit?phase=2&url=http://techie-buzz.com/microsoft/how-to-view-and-edit-raw-photos-on-windows-live-photo-gallery.html&title=How-To View and Edit RAW Photos in Windows Live Photo Gallery" rel="bookmark" target="_blank">Digg This</a> | <a href="http://www.reddit.com/submit?url=http://techie-buzz.com/microsoft/how-to-view-and-edit-raw-photos-on-windows-live-photo-gallery.html&title=How-To View and Edit RAW Photos in Windows Live Photo Gallery" rel="bookmark" target="_blank">Reddit This</a></div> <br /><div><strong style="font-size:11px;">TAGS:</strong> <span style="text-transform:uppercase;font-size:11px;"><a href="http://techie-buzz.com/tag/cameras" rel="tag">Cameras</a>, <a href="http://techie-buzz.com/tag/how-to" rel="tag">How To</a>, <a href="http://techie-buzz.com/tag/photography" rel="tag">Photography</a>, <a href="http://techie-buzz.com/tag/windows-7" rel="tag">Windows 7</a>, <a href="http://techie-buzz.com/tag/windows-live" rel="tag">Windows Live</a></span><br/> </small></div><div style="background:#E1E1E1; border: dotted 1px; padding:5px; margin-top:5px;font-size:11px"> <a href="http://techie-buzz.com/microsoft/how-to-view-and-edit-raw-photos-on-windows-live-photo-gallery.html" title="How-To View and Edit RAW Photos in Windows Live Photo Gallery">How-To View and Edit RAW Photos in Windows Live Photo Gallery</a> originally appeared on <a href="http://techie-buzz.com" title="Techie Buzz">Techie Buzz</a> written by Abhishek Baxi on Tuesday 26th July 2011 05:45:39 PM under <a href="http://techie-buzz.com/category/microsoft" title="View all posts in Microsoft" rel="category tag">Microsoft</a>.
